Course Content

• Fundamentals of Light and Wavelength
• Light Sources and Spectral Analysis (including LED technology and laser principles)
• Interaction of Light with Matter (Absorption, Reflection, Refraction, Scattering)
• Optical Instrumentation and Measurement Techniques (Spectrophotometry, interferometry)
• Advanced Light Wavelength Applications (e.g., Spectroscopy, Fiber Optics, Photovoltaics)
• Light Wavelength in Medical Applications (e.g., Laser surgery, Photodynamic therapy)
• Health and Safety Regulations for Light Wavelength Technologies
• Light Wavelength and Environmental Monitoring
• Calibration and Quality Control in Light Wavelength Measurements

Career path

Certified Specialist Programme in Light Wavelength: UK Job Market Outlook

Explore the exciting career paths available with a specialization in Light Wavelength technology.

Career Role Description
Photonics Engineer (Light Wavelength Specialist) Develop and implement advanced light-based technologies, focusing on laser systems, optical fiber communication, and optical imaging. High demand in the UK's thriving technology sector.
Optical Scientist (Light Wavelength Researcher) Conduct research and development in areas such as spectroscopy, quantum optics, and biomedical optics. A strong understanding of light wavelengths is crucial for success in this role.
Laser Technician (Light Wavelength Application) Maintain and repair laser systems used in various industries including manufacturing, healthcare, and research. Requires practical skills and a solid understanding of laser safety.
